The Secret of Midway (Ghosts of War #1)

par Steve Watkins

In the basement of his family's junkshop, Anderson and his friends Greg and Julie discover a trunk full of old military stuff. Including a battered navy peacoat from World War II. When Anderson puts it on he finds a mysterious letter in the pocket. Curious, he takes the coat and letter home. But that's not all he brings home. Later that evening the ghost of a World War II sailor appears in Anderson's room. Anderson is completely freaked out. Anderson, Greg, and Julie set out to find out why this ghost hasn't crossed over and the are soon wrapped up in a mystery that's over seventy years old. It quickly becomes a race against the clock as they search to put the clues of sailor's life together before he vanishes for good.… (plus d'informations)

Ghosts of War is a new middle grade series from Scholastic, Inc. A twist of mystery, historical fiction, and middle school drama, these books are aimed at middle grade boys with an interest in war fiction. The series stars a trio of friends who meet a ghost and help him remember his mortal life and solve the mystery of his death.

This is a content-free, fast-paced read about an important moment in history. Readers learn about a famous US naval battle without feeling like history is being shoved down their throats. While there is talk of gunfire, death, and violence between the Japanese and American forces, it's not at all graphic or frightening.

Overall, it's a solid middle grade read that offers an educational bonus that parents and educators can feel good about. A second book in the series is forthcoming in April! ( )
